The implementation of mesh fencing for livestock protection has been a topic of growing interest among farmers and agricultural experts alike. This report aims to explore the impact that such fencing solutions have on both the health and wellbeing of animals, presenting evidence-based insights into how these systems contribute positively to farm management practices.
One of the most significant advantages of employing mesh fencing for livestock protection is its ability to enhance security. Traditional barriers, such as wooden fences or barbed wire, can be easily compromised by determined predators or even by the natural wear and tear over time. In contrast, modern mesh fencing designs are specifically engineered to withstand various forms of stress, including attempts at intrusion by wildlife. The tight weave of the mesh makes it difficult for smaller predators like foxes, coyotes, and weasels to penetrate, thereby significantly reducing the risk of attacks on livestock. Moreover, the visibility provided by mesh fencing allows farmers to monitor their herds more effectively, contributing to an overall safer environment for the animals.
A well-designed enclosure plays a crucial role in maintaining the physical and mental health of livestock. Mesh fencing not only provides a secure boundary but also ensures that the living space remains open and airy, which is essential for the comfort of the animals. Unlike solid walls, which can create a sense of confinement and stress, mesh fencing allows for natural light and airflow, promoting a healthier microclimate within the enclosure. This is particularly important for preventing respiratory issues and other health problems associated with poor ventilation. Additionally, the see-through nature of the mesh helps reduce aggression and anxiety among herd members, as they can maintain visual contact with each other and with their surroundings, supporting a more stable social structure.
Sustainability is becoming increasingly important in agriculture, and the use of mesh fencing for livestock protection aligns well with this trend. These fences are typically made from durable materials that offer long-term resistance to weather and corrosion, reducing the need for frequent replacements. This longevity translates into lower maintenance costs and less environmental impact compared to traditional fencing options. Furthermore, the design of mesh fencing often includes features that minimize the risk of injury to animals, such as smooth edges and appropriate spacing between wires, ensuring that the fencing does not pose a hazard to the livestock. By providing a safe and sustainable solution, mesh fencing supports the broader goals of responsible farming, including the welfare of the animals and the preservation of the land.
Effective farm management relies on the ability to efficiently monitor and control the movement of livestock. Mesh fencing for livestock protection offers several advantages in this regard. The transparency of the mesh allows for easy observation of the animals without the need for constant physical presence, enabling farmers to quickly identify any signs of distress or illness. This early detection capability is critical for timely intervention and treatment, potentially saving lives and reducing the spread of diseases. Additionally, the flexibility in the design of mesh fencing means that it can be easily adapted to different terrains and farm layouts, facilitating the creation of specific zones for feeding, resting, and breeding, which further enhances the overall efficiency of farm operations.
In conclusion, the adoption of mesh fencing for livestock protection represents a comprehensive approach to enhancing the health, safety, and overall wellbeing of farm animals. By providing enhanced security, improving animal welfare, promoting sustainable practices, and facilitating efficient management, mesh fencing stands out as a valuable tool for modern agricultural settings. As the industry continues to evolve, the integration of such innovative solutions will undoubtedly play a key role in shaping the future of livestock farming, ensuring that both the animals and the environment are treated with the utmost care and respect.
